About the Team:
At Deep South Today, we’re dedicated to reshaping the landscape of local journalism in the Deep South. Our DST Connect initiative is the driving force behind this mission, aiming to empower local newsrooms with innovative strategies and tools for sustainable growth. In this vital role, you’ll be a key member of the DST Connect team, where your work will directly impact our network of local newsrooms.

Key Responsibilities:

1. Community Engagement and Outreach:

  • Develop and execute strategies to foster deeper connections between the newsrooms and their communities
  • Organize and participate in community events, forums, and discussions to gather feedback and story ideas

2. Spanish Translation of Stories:

  • Translate selected stories into Spanish, ensuring accuracy and cultural relevance
  • Occasionally provide bilingual reporting and produce high-quality, translated content

3. Video Content Creation:

  • Develop and produce engaging video content that complements and enhances news stories
  • Collaborate with reporters, editors and contracted talent to storyboard and script video segments

4. Multimedia Content Innovation:

  • Explore and implement innovative multimedia content formats, including podcasts, interactive graphics, and photo essays
  • Stay abreast of emerging trends and technologies in multimedia journalism

5. Cross-Platform Content Distribution:

  • Ensure that multimedia content is effectively distributed across various platforms, including websites, social media, and mobile apps
  • Work with the Tech & Web Development Specialist to optimize content for different digital mediums

6. Collaboration with DST Connect Team:

  • Collaborate with other DST Connect team members, including the Brand & Product Designer and Distribution & Engagement Specialist, to align multimedia content with overall digital strategy
  • Participate in regular team meetings and provide updates on project progress

Deliverables:

  • Regular production of Spanish-translated stories, ensuring a steady stream of bilingual content
  • Creation of engaging video content, including news clips, feature stories, and informational segments
  • Innovative multimedia projects that enhance storytelling and audience engagement
  • Reports on community feedback, engagement metrics, and effectiveness of multimedia content

Contract Details:

  • Duration: The contract will initially be for a period of 12 months
  • Hours: Up to 20 hours per week
  • Reporting: The Community Engagement & Multimedia Specialist will report to the Director of Growth & Innovation at Deep South Today.

Qualifications:

  • Experience in multimedia content production and community engagement
  • Fluent in both English and Spanish, with experience in translation and creating bilingual content
  • Strong understanding of digital media platforms and content distribution strategies
  • Creative storytelling skills and proficiency in video production and editing tools
  • Excellent communication and collaboration abilities
  • A solid foundation in journalism
